Design and Construction Characteristics

When it comes to material selection, compact welded hydraulic cylinders are commonly crafted from durable materials such as steel and aluminum. The welded technology used, including techniques like MIG and TIG welding, ensures a seamless and robust construction. These cylinders are designed to be compact in size, making them ideal for space-constrained applications.

Mounting Options

Compact welded hydraulic cylinders offer a variety of mounting configurations, including side mounts, flange mounts, and trunnion mounts. These options provide flexibility in installation and allow for efficient integration into HVAC systems.

Working Principle of Compact Welded Hydraulic Cylinder

The working principle of a compact welded hydraulic cylinder involves the transfer of force through a liquid medium, resulting in piston movement and workload handling. The sealing system in these cylinders ensures efficient performance, while pressure release mechanisms maintain system integrity.

Types and Configurations

Compact welded hydraulic cylinders come in three main types: single-acting, double-acting, and telescopic. Each type offers unique configurations to suit different HVAC applications, providing optimal functionality and reliability.
